About Basak Malutlut

Basak Malutlut is a constituent barangay of Marawi in Lanao del Sur. Flood risk varies within Marawi — a property-level investigation is essential before any purchase. Like many Philippine barangays, this community has grown organically over time, producing a layered residential landscape where older structures sit alongside newer developments. Local families and employed workers looking for permanent, practical homes make up the dominant buyer segment in Basak Malutlut. Available properties — house-and-lot units, townhouses, and low-rise condominiums at stable price points — are priced to reflect Marawi's broader market positioning within Lanao del Sur. Title verification at the local Registry of Deeds is an essential pre-purchase step.

Flood Risk

Flood Risk Varies

Variable flood risk in Basak Malutlut requires individual property assessment. Marawi's heterogeneous terrain creates pockets of safety and vulnerability within the same barangay. Ask the seller to disclose any past flooding events and verify independently through barangay DRRMO records before signing any reservation agreement.
